Ingredients
Quantities are shown as originally provided.
- 4 Tbsp. olive oil or ghee
- 1 ½ cups chopped yellow onion
- 3 tsp. curry powder (divided)
- 2 tsp. kosher salt (divided)
- 1 tsp. pepper (divided)
- 2 Tbsp. minced fresh ginger
- 2 Tbsp. minced fresh garlic
- 2 lb. boneless skinless chicken thighs
- 3 cups cauliflower florets
- 1 13.66 oz. can unsweetened coconut milk
- 1 cup frozen English peas
- 1 Tbsp. fresh lime juice (optional)
- ½ to 1 cup plain whole milk yogurt (optional)
- Hot cooked rice and toasted naan (to serve)
- Fresh cilantro leaves and lime wedges (for garnish)
Instructions
- 1
Set a 6-quart Instant Pot to saute; add olive oil.
- 2
When oil is warm, add onion, 1 teaspoon curry powder, and ½ teaspoon salt.
- 3
Saute 5 minutes, stirring occasionally. Add garlic and ginger. Cook 1 minute more.
- 4
Sprinkle chicken with remaining 2 teaspoons curry powder, 1/1/2 teaspoons salt, and ½ teaspoon pepper. Add to Instant Pot; cook 2 minutes on each side.
- 5
Press Cancel to reset Instant Pot.
- 6
Add cauliflower to Instant Pot; pour in coconut milk.
- 7
Place top on Instant Pot; twist to seal and lock. Turn Steam Release Valve to “sealing.”
- 8
Set Instant Pot to cook at High Pressure for 8 minutes.
- 9
After cooking is complete, manually release the pressure by turning the Steam Release Valve to “venting.”
- 10
Remove lid; shred chicken with 2 forks. Stir in 1 cup frozen peas, lime juice, and yogurt, if desired. Let curry stand 5 minutes.
- 11
Serve curry with rice and naan bread. Garnish with cilantro and lime wedges, if desired.
